B

Beam Setter

Equipment used to check the alignment of vehicle headlights.

Bearing Cap

Half-round parts that holds the big end and main bearings into place either on the con rods or engine block.

Bearing Clearance

The freeplay between a bearing shell and journal.

Bearing Nip or Crush

Applies to the applied grip of a split shell bearing when the two halves are tightened together.

Bearings

Components used to support a shaft and allow rotation.

Bell Housing

Cover over the clutch assembly. Usually joins the gearbox to the engine.

Benign

A benign condition is one that is not usually serious or harmful. Zero emissions for example.

Benzole

Hydrocarbon fuel additive and octane improver.

Bevel Gears

Gears cut at an angle from the periphery so that they can transmit a drive through an angle. An example is the final drive crown wheel and pinion.
